Album covers

Hey, noticed your query over the album covers not being free to use. I'm no image expert but album covers are usually allowed to be used under Fair Use, but only to illustrate something that is directly related to the image. In other words, you can use the image in the article about the album itself, but not in an article which indirectly discusses it. So, in summary, they don't belong in the band article, just a discography list will do.

I should note that all Fair Use images require a specific fair use rationale to be provided on the image's page explaining its use. See Image:Queen_A_Day_At_The_Races.png for an example. The Rambling Man 12:57, 15 August 2007 (UTC)
